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ques Receives Eid Al-Fitr Well-Wishers

Makkah, The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ques, King Salman bin Abdulaziz Al Saud, received at the Royal Court at Al-Safa Palace here after Eid Al-Fitr prayer today Lebanese Prime Minister Saad Al-Hariri, Military Commander of the Islamic Military Counter Terrorism Coalition Gen. Raheel Sharif and a number of princes, scholars, sheikhs and senior civil and military officials who came to congratulate the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ques on Eid Al-Fitr.

They had breakfast with the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ques.

The audience was attended by Prince Faisal bin Turki bin Abdullah, Prince Khalid Al-Faisal bin Abdulaziz, Advisor to the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ques and Governor of Makkah Region; and a number of princes.
